编程不仅仅是一门技术,更是一种思维方式的体现。从零基础到高手,培养编程创新思维是一个持续学习和实践的过程。以下是一些方法和建议,帮助你在这个过程中不断成长。
一、基础知识要扎实
1. 学习编程语言
掌握一门或几门编程语言是基础中的基础。Python、Java、C++等都是不错的选择。了解它们的基本语法、数据结构和算法,为你后续的创新思维打下坚实的基础。
2. 掌握常用库和框架
了解并掌握一些常用的库和框架,如Django、Flask、React等,可以让你在开发过程中更加高效,也有助于你从不同的角度思考问题。
二、不断拓宽知识面
1. 学习计算机科学知识
计算机科学是一个庞大的领域,涉及算法、数据结构、计算机网络、操作系统等多个方面。了解这些知识,可以帮助你从更全面的角度思考编程问题。
2. 关注业界动态
关注业界动态,了解最新的技术、趋势和工具,可以帮助你保持创新思维。
三、实践出真知
1. 多做项目
通过实际项目,你可以将所学知识运用到实际中,发现问题、解决问题。多参与项目,可以提高你的编程能力,同时锻炼你的创新思维。
2. 参加编程竞赛
编程竞赛是一个很好的锻炼机会,它可以让你在短时间内接触到各种问题,提高你的解题能力和创新能力。
四、培养良好的思维习惯
1. 保持好奇心
好奇心是创新思维的源泉。对于未知的事物,保持好奇,勇于探索。
2. 学会反思
在项目开发过程中,遇到问题时,要学会反思,总结经验教训,为以后的项目积累经验。
3. 培养逆向思维
逆向思维可以帮助你从不同的角度思考问题,找到解决问题的独特方法。
五、借鉴他人的经验
1. 阅读经典书籍
阅读经典书籍,了解前人的经验和智慧,可以帮助你少走弯路。
2. 关注业界大牛
关注业界大牛,学习他们的经验和思维方法,可以帮助你快速成长。
3. 参加线上课程
参加线上课程,学习他人的经验和技巧,可以让你在短时间内提升自己的能力。
通过以上这些方法,相信你在编程创新思维的道路上会越走越远。记住,创新思维不是一蹴而就的,需要你持续学习和实践。祝你早日成为编程高手!
